Canceled: Dividing Late Season Perennials Workshop
Monday, May 4, 2020
Take a walk with us through the demonstration gardens to evaluate the performance of the daffodils and tulips, and mark those which will require attention later in the season. We will note any mid-season plants that may need to be divided after blooming. This will be a hands-on activity. Bring gloves, spading forks and containers to lift, divide, and transplant ornamental grasses and sedums. Presented by Kate Ruffer. http://www.udel.edu/007167
